Problems solved by technology

According to the actual application experience in the field, the distribution network fault phase identification method based on the fault steady-state component is easily affected by the grid structure, line parameters and fault conditions, and the sensitivity of phase selection is low in the case of high-impedance grounding. The applicability of the state quantity phase selection method in the actual power grid needs further research

[0038] The present invention will be further described below in conjunction with the accompanying drawings and embodiments.

[0039] Step 1. Once a permanent single-phase ground fault occurs, use a current transformer to perform high-speed sampling of the current of each phase within 20 ms after the fault occurs and 20 ms before the fault occurs to obtain the current sampling data of each phase; The current sampling data of 20ms after the moment corresponds to the subtraction of the current sampling data of the first 20ms, as shown in formula (1)(2)(3) to obtain q aj ,q bj ,q cj .

[0040] q aj = i a(t+fj) -i a(t+fj-20) (1)

[0041] q bj = i b(t+fj) -i b(t+fj-20) (2)

[0042] q cj = i c(t+fj) -i c(t+fj-20) (3)

The invention provides an ineffective grounding power distribution network single-phase grounding fault phase selection method based on grey correlation analysis. The method includes steps: performinghigh-speed sampling on each phase current 20 ms after and before a fault generation moment, and obtaining sampling data of each phase current; subtracting the current sampling data 20 ms before the fault moment from the current sampling data 20 ms after the fault moment of each phase, obtaining a fault transient-state quantity of each phase current, and performing normalized and standardized processing on the fault transient-state quantities of the phase currents; calculating the association degrees of the fault transient-state quantities between A-phase and B-phase, A-phase and C-phase, andB-phase and C-phase currents, and calculating the average association degrees of the fault transient-state quantities of the phase currents, specifically the averages of the association degrees between each phase and other two phases; finally calculating a fault evaluation index of each phase, specifically the sum of absolute values of differences between the average association degree of the phase and the average association degrees of the other two phases; and fifthly, determining a fault phase determination threshold, and determining the phase is the fault phase if the fault evaluation index is higher than the fault phase determination threshold.

technical field [0001] The invention belongs to the technical field of non-effectively grounded distribution networks, and in particular relates to a new method for single-phase ground fault phase selection based on gray relational analysis. Background technique [0002] As the total number and total length of 10kV feeders in the medium-voltage distribution network continue to increase, the single-phase ground fault current value of the neutral point non-effectively grounded system rises sharply, and the resulting permanent ground fault and arc overvoltage are easy to correct The safe and reliable operation of the distribution network brings serious hazards.
